WebResources. Children, newborns and mothers have a greater chance of surviving today than they did just three decades ago. The world has witnessed a stunning reduction in child … WebWhen The State of the World’s Children first went into print in 1980, 10 per cent of the children born that year died from preventable causes. By 2024, that number had declined to just 3 per cent. WebJun 10, 2024 · To our knowledge, this study is the first effort to systematically quantify the transgenerational importance of education for child survival at the global level. The results showed that lower maternal and paternal education are both risk factors for child mortality, even after controlling for other markers of family socioeconomic status. This study …

However, the decline in neonatal ... setfileattributes msdnWebThe Child Survival and Safe Motherhood Programme jointly funded by World Bank and UNICEF was started in 1992-93 for implementation up to 1997-98. The Child Survival and Safe Motherhood Programme was implemented in a phased manner covering all the districts of the country by the year 1996-97.
